In FreeIPA, Managed Entries are globally managed via the replicated space. When you enable Managed Entries, you enable it on ALL replicas, so currently, when a modification occurs that requires Managed Entry to update a MEP, the result is a small storm as each replica server runs the Managed Entry task and replicates the change.
There should be an option to omit replicating the Managed Entry modifications.

This should be a non issue since Managed Entries is programed NOT to fire on replicated actions...
